About 5-(9-methyl-3,9-diazabicyclo[4.2.1]nonane-3-carbonyl)pyridine-2-carboxylic acid
5-(9-methyl-3,9-diazabicyclo[4.2.1]nonane-3-carbonyl)pyridine-2-carboxylic acid (PubChem CID 79117582) has the molecular formula C15H19N3O3
and a molecular weight of 289.33 g/mol. Its IUPAC name is 5-(9-methyl-3,9-diazabicyclo[4.2.1]nonane-3-carbonyl)pyridine-2-carboxylic acid.

What is the SMILES notation for 5-(9-methyl-3,9-diazabicyclo[4.2.1]nonane-3-carbonyl)pyridine-2-carboxylic acid?
The canonical SMILES for 5-(9-methyl-3,9-diazabicyclo[4.2.1]nonane-3-carbonyl)pyridine-2-carboxylic acid is CN1C2CCC1CN(C(=O)c1ccc(C(=O)O)nc1)CC2.
What is the InChIKey of 5-(9-methyl-3,9-diazabicyclo[4.2.1]nonane-3-carbonyl)pyridine-2-carboxylic acid?
The InChIKey is UWCRJAZXPRWGQR-UHFFFAOYSA-N. The full InChI is InChI=1S/C15H19N3O3/c1-17-11-3-4-12(17)9-18(7-6-11)14(19)10-2-5-13(15(20)21)16-8-10/h2,5,8,11-12H,3-4,6-7,9H2,1H3,(H,20,21).
What are the key properties of 5-(9-methyl-3,9-diazabicyclo[4.2.1]nonane-3-carbonyl)pyridine-2-carboxylic acid?
5-(9-methyl-3,9-diazabicyclo[4.2.1]nonane-3-carbonyl)pyridine-2-carboxylic acid has a molecular weight of 289.33 g/mol, XLogP of 1.09, 2 rotatable bonds, 1 hydrogen bond donors, and 4 hydrogen bond acceptors.
